After the September 11th tragedy, many Canadians have asked what can they do to help.
Wellll … what they can do is accept Mayor Giuliani and Governor Pataki’s invitation to come to New York. They can be there for the “Canada Loves New York” Weekend November 30 – December 2.
Canadians will all come together on Saturday at 2:30 p.m. at the Roseland Ballroom in NYC for a big Canada Loves New York rally. The ticket for admission is a Canadian passport.
There are low air fares offered through Air Canada ($179 Cdn return) and Greyhound bus fare return is $99 Cdn from Nov 28 – Dec 4 and Sheraton, Westin and W Hotels are offering hotel rates from $169 (yup U.S. lol).
The Canada Loves New York Weekend is more than a good time. It is a historic occasion. It is Canada’s demonstration of solidarity and support for a great city in its time of greatest need.
